An unforgettable day in the Montserrat mountains
Escape the hustle and bustle of Barcelona and immerse yourself in the majestic mountains of Montserrat. This guided day tour takes you to one of Catalonia's most impressive sites – the UNESCO World Heritage Site of Montserrat, renowned for its breathtaking landscape and centuries-old spiritual significance.
Your adventure begins in the morning at a bar in Barcelona's city centre, where you'll meet your guide. Together, you'll set off into the mountains. During the informative bus journey, you'll learn fascinating details about the region and its history. Soon, you'll reach the spectacular mountain landscape of Montserrat, with its distinctive rock formations rising dramatically into the sky.
Upon arrival, you'll explore the famous Montserrat Monastery on a guided tour. Your guide will share the fascinating history of this spiritual place, which has attracted pilgrims and visitors from around the world for over 1,000 years. The highlight of the tour is a visit to the basilica, where you can admire the revered Black Madonna – "La Moreneta". This statue is one of Catalonia's most important religious symbols.
Afterwards, you'll have three hours of free time to explore Montserrat at your own pace. The possibilities are diverse: take a hike through the mystical hills and enjoy spectacular views, visit the museum to learn more about the cultural history, or treat yourself to a leisurely lunch with panoramic views. A trip on the funicular railway, which takes you even higher into the mountains, is particularly recommended (additional cost).
After this unforgettable time in the mountains, you'll meet up with the group at the bus again. You'll travel back to Barcelona in comfort, arriving in plenty of time for a lovely evening in the city. The entire tour lasts approximately six hours and offers you the perfect blend of culture, nature and freedom.

Visitor information
Tour times
The tour runs daily from 9 AM to 3 PM.
Meeting Point:
Kulas, Passeig de Colom 7, 08002 Barcelona, Spain
Meet your guide outside the bar or wait inside with a drink.
Good to know
During the winter months of January and February, there may be cancellations during the week. However, the tour runs regularly throughout the year.
Dress code: shoulders and knees must be covered in the basilica. In summer, you should bring suncream and a hat; in winter, a warm jacket. Sturdy footwear is recommended if you plan to go hiking.
The funicular ride is not included in the tour price, but is highly recommended for spectacular views.
